Skip to content

Commit

Permalink
NH-92598: use gradle.properties to set otel versions
Browse files Browse the repository at this point in the history
  • Loading branch information
cleverchuk committed Oct 1, 2024
1 parent 75e845c commit f36696c
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 3 deletions.
6 changes: 3 additions & 3 deletions build.gradle
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@ buildscript {
dependencies {
classpath "com.diffplug.spotless:spotless-plugin-gradle:6.14.0"
classpath "com.github.johnrengelman:shadow:8.1.1"
classpath "io.opentelemetry.instrumentation:gradle-plugins:2.7.0-alpha"
classpath "io.opentelemetry.instrumentation:gradle-plugins:${property('otel.agent.version')}-alpha"
}
}

Expand All @@ -44,8 +44,8 @@ subprojects {

ext {
versions = [
opentelemetry : "1.42.1",
opentelemetryJavaagent: "2.8.0",
opentelemetry : property('otel.sdk.version'), // property is defined in gradle.properties
opentelemetryJavaagent: property('otel.agent.version'),
bytebuddy : "1.12.10",
guava : "30.1-jre",
joboe : "10.0.12",
Expand Down
4 changes: 4 additions & 0 deletions gradle.properties
Original file line number Diff line number Diff line change
Expand Up @@ -17,3 +17,7 @@ systemProp.org.gradle.internal.http.connectionTimeout=120000
systemProp.org.gradle.internal.http.socketTimeout=120000
systemProp.org.gradle.internal.repository.max.retries=10
systemProp.org.gradle.internal.repository.initial.backoff=500

# Project properties provides a central place for shared property among subprojects
otel.agent.version=2.8.0
otel.sdk.version=1.42.1

0 comments on commit f36696c

Please sign in to comment.